SIR by R.J. Lewis
The conclusion to the Mister West Duet.

Ivy: I have showed up to Aidan West's door and he...doesn't remember a thing. My mission just got infinitely worse. Any hope of spontaneous recovery fades away to nonexistence.
I have to do this the hard way.
I have been tasked to "bring Aidan back."
But it's not that easy.
West is a bossy asshole and I am the most hopeless assistant to ever grace this planet. I would know--he tells me. He also threatens to fire me every five seconds while simultaneously asking me to stop wearing those short skirts. I refuse to, of course.
I am not easy, he is not easy -- we are a very dysfunctional couple, and while at times I want to cry, break down, walk away, sputter a curse and tell him to go f*ck himself, I know in my heart I must stay.
Because I can't give up on Aidan. He is the love of my life.
He needs me, even if he doesn't know it--remember it--yet.
